NOTE: Northern Kentucky University has established abbreviations for its various disciplines. These abbreviations, which are printed below each discipline in the following course descriptions, should be used in preparing course schedules and at other times when referring to specific courses. Following most course titles are three figures in parentheses. The first of these indicates the number of lecture hours in the course; the second, the number of laboratory hours; and the third, the number of semester hours of credit.
